Question: Hi Doctor,
my daughter 6 years old is having fever since last two days. it's consistently around 100 - 101. I have been giving her crocon ds 5 ml thrice sice day before yesterday and augmentin duo 5 ml thrice since yesterday . there is no cough or sneezing .no pain anywhere. she is eating properly but just become lazy and less active. what should we do
doctor
Answered by Dr. Diptanshu Das (21 minutes later)
Brief Answer:
Complete the course of antibiotics

Detailed Answer:
Thanks for asking on HealthcareMagic.

Most often fevers in children are due to viral cause. In such cases antibiotics are ineffective and irrespective of treatment it takes 5-7 days for recovery to occur. You have already started antibiotics and so you must complete the course. Give Crocin DS (paracetamol) whenever there is fever. Also give tepid sponging.

You need to be patient. If apprehensive, get her blood tested for complete blood count (CBC) and C-Reactive protein (CRP). You can also visit your doctor.

fever is constant around 100 and 101 , not going below 100 . so giving crocin Ds 5 ml thrice in a day along with augmebtin 5 ml. anythibg else we can do to reduce the fever.
doctor
Answered by Dr. Diptanshu Das (1 hour later)
Brief Answer:
Mefenamic acid is more effective than paracetamol.

Detailed Answer:
You can give Meftal P (mefenamic acid) syrup (prescription medicine) as it is more effective than Crocin DS in reducing fever. The dose is 7.5 mg/kg/dose to be given at a minimum interval of 6-8 hours but independent of the dose of Crocin DS.

with Meftal P fever has reduced to 99 but nose has bleeded thrice during day .. bleeding is for few seconds only and then stopped. is it ok. should we do anything.
doctor
Answered by Dr. Diptanshu Das (30 minutes later)
Brief Answer:
Not related

Detailed Answer:
I do not think that the nose bleed is related to Meftal P. It can be due to nasal dryness during a cold. However if it recurs it would be a good idea to visit a doctor.
